Writing ideas aplenty

While I have a tendency to write in specific fields due to my background and expertise, I still get tons of writing ideas on all sorts of topics…like how to customize a frozen pizza.

So what’s a writer to do with all those ideas floating around in her head? Well, write and then put them out there in the world so people can read ‘em, of course!

I keep a running list of short article ideas. Most of these ideas are clearly short, online content fodder only. Definitely not worth the time and energy to write on spec and then submit to publications with query letters.

As the ideas come, I just add them to my running list in Word. When I type an article up, I cross that idea off the list. I know, pretty basic.

The ideas can come from anywhere. The customized pizza idea? That one came from my husband. He can take the most basic of frozen pizzas and just add a couple of items from the cupboard and fridge and a quarter of an hour later - an ultra tasty pizza emerges from the oven. Sick, but oh so true.

I’ve contemplated creating a separate site to sell those articles that have little to do with my “normal” writing work. But why reinvent the wheel? For now, I’m trying out Associated Content. I wrote some articles on there years ago…so long ago that I don’t even remember my login. So I’m starting from scratch. But that’s less work then cranking out another website that I’ll have little time to take care of.

My next shorty (my new name for a short article) might be on Mommy Group Etiquette. Or maybe it will be on How to Design a Memorial Tombstone. Yep, my interests go from one end of the spectrum to the other.
